Renewed Contract -New Router?

As per title really, just renewed our contract for Unlimited Fibre Extra last week and I was under the impression that PN sent out the new Hub 2 router for renewals but reading more into it now I'm not so sure.

We have no major issues with the Hub 1, apart from a couple of our phones routinely dropping connection and we have to re-enter password etc, but was hoping for the new 'improved' router to hopefully improve things.

I've read conflicting articles/posts saying that if you call up you can get one sent out for p+p cost but others saying you have to buy one for £100!

Re: Renewed Contract -New Router?

As you have just renewed then call up Plusnet and ask nicely if they will send out a new Hub 2 for the cost only P&P saying you though the renewal would automatically trigger a new router especially when the existing one is so old.

Or wait here for 3 to 7 days (average response time) and a member of staff maybe able to help on those terms too.

Generally the £100 is when the router fails after a year and a day (only guaranteed for 365 days) and it isn't worth that. Ore you are well outside of a renewal date and then tough luck. A trip to Argos can get you going for a lot less and with a better device in those cases.

Re: Renewed Contract -New Router?

@Turvey1  Welcome to the Community forum.

You don't get a 'free' new Hub unless you ask for one when you renew. Ring the Customer Options Team on 0800 013 2632, explain that you recently renewed and ask for one. This number is normally answered quite quickly.
